Nuts - Kabuklu yemişler[edit | edit source]

Almond - Badem

Brazil Nut - Brezilya Fındığı

Cacao - Kakao

Cashew - Kaju

Chesnut - Kestane

Coconut - Hindistan Cevizi

Hazelnut - Fındık

Macadamia Nut - Makadamya fındığı

Peanut - Yer Fıstığı

Pecan - Pikan

Pili Nut - Pili Bademi

Pine Nut - Çamiçi

Pistachio - Fıstık / Antep fıstığı

Soy Nut - soya Fasülyesi

Sunflower Seed - Ayçekirdeği

Pumpkin Seed - Kabak Çekirdeği

Roasted ........ - Kavrulmuş ..............

Salted ............ - Tuzlu ......................

Unsated ......... - Tuzsuz ..................

Berries - dutlar ya da Üzümler ( Actually there is no complete translation of berries in Turkish but i can call mulberries or grapes ( dutlar veya üzümler ) )[edit | edit source]

Grape - Üzüm

Currant - Frenk Üzümü

Elderberry - Mürver

Oregon grape - Oregon üzümü

Gooseberry - Bektaşi üzümü

Acai - Asayi / Asayi Üzümü

Gojiberry - Goji / Kurt Üzümü

Rosehip - Kuşburnu

Cranberry - Turna yemişi

Crowberry - Karga üzümü

Blueberry - Mavi yemiş ( some people tranlate it as yaban mersini but yaban mersini is red but blueberry is darkblue hence i tranlate it as mavi yemiş)

Raspberry - Ahududu

Strawberry - Çilek

Blackberry - Bögürtlen

Mulberry - Dut

Citrus - Narenciye / turunçgiller[edit | edit source]

Lemon - Limon

Grapefruit - Greyfurt

Mandarin - Mandalina

Orange - Portakal
